Exegesis

In the verbless clause YHWH {יְהוָ֛ה | Yə-hō-wāh} miš-ʿān lî {מִשְׁעָ֖ן לִֽי | miš-ʿān lî} ‘the LORD was a support to me’, placing the divine name first heightens the focus on divine assistance, and the suffix in miš-ʿān underscores personal reliance.

Root and etymology

ש־ע־ן

to support, lean on
